I heard the same thing, but this is Dropbox not Google. I doubt they're using high end SAS drives, but they're probably using something more along the lines of the WD SE drives as opposed to WD Greens (or equivalent). I've had extremely high failure rates with greens - my last RAID5 consisted of 5 1.5TB greens, 2 died within the warranty period, 2 died within months after the warranty period ended, and one of the original warranty replacements died after that. ~70% failure rate in 2.5 years. Yuck. Hooray for backups.
